#d190d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d190d4 is composed of 82% red, 56.5%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.4% cyan, 32.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 297.4 degrees, a saturation of 44.2% and a lightness of 69.8%. #d190d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a321a9.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#d190d4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#faf3f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#d190d4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6aeb6 is the less saturated color, while #f767fd is the most saturated one.
